动态网页前端框架的构建方式多种多样,不仅仅是一种技术手段,更是对用户体验和开发效率的追求。在不同的场景和需求下,前端框架的选择和搭建方式也各有特点。无论是传统的MVC模式,还是现代化的MVVM框架,都在不断演进和创新,为开发者提供更加高效和灵活的开发方式。本文将从不同的角度探讨动态网页前端框架的构建方式,帮助读者更好地理解和运用这些技术。
1、动态网页前端框架的构建方式
动态网页前端框架的构建方式
随着互联网的迅猛发展,动态网页成为了人们日常生活中不可或缺的一部分。而动态网页的前端框架,作为构建动态网页的重要工具,也越来越受到开发者的关注。本文将介绍一些常见的动态网页前端框架的构建方式。
我们来了解一下什么是前端框架。前端框架是一种用于构建用户界面的工具集合,它能够提供一系列的组件和功能,帮助开发者更高效地创建网页应用。动态网页前端框架则是在静态网页的基础上,加入了动态交互和数据处理的能力。
目前,市场上有很多优秀的动态网页前端框架,其中更受欢迎的包括React、Angular和Vue.js等。这些框架都具有各自独特的特点和优势。
React是由Facebook开发的一个用于构建用户界面的JavaScript库。它采用了组件化的开发方式,将页面划分为独立的组件,使得代码更加模块化和可复用。React使用虚拟DOM(Virtual DOM)来提高页面渲染的性能,同时也提供了丰富的生命周期方法和状态管理机制,方便开发者进行页面的动态更新。
Angular是由Google开发的一个完整的前端框架。它采用了MVVM(Model-View-ViewModel)的架构模式,通过数据绑定和依赖注入等技术,实现了数据和视图的双向绑定,减少了开发者的工作量。Angular还提供了丰富的指令、过滤器和服务等功能,使得开发者可以更加灵活地构建动态网页。
Vue.js是一个轻量级的前端框架,也是近年来备受关注的新星。Vue.js采用了组件化的开发方式,类似于React,但它更加简单易用。Vue.js提供了响应式的数据绑定和组件化的视图组织方式,同时还支持虚拟DOM和异步渲染等特性,使得开发者可以快速构建高效的动态网页。
无论是哪种动态网页前端框架,它们的构建方式都有一些共同的特点。需要掌握HTML、CSS和JavaScript等基础知识,因为这些框架都是基于这些技术来进行开发的。需要了解框架的基本原理和使用方法,例如React的组件化开发、Angular的数据绑定和Vue.js的响应式数据等。需要有一定的实践经验,通过实际项目的开发来提升自己的技能。
总结一下,动态网页前端框架的构建方式是多种多样的,每种框架都有其独特的特点和优势。无论是React、Angular还是Vue.js,它们都可以帮助开发者更高效地构建动态网页。掌握这些框架的构建方式,将会为开发者带来更多的机会和挑战。希望本文对大家了解动态网页前端框架的构建方式有所帮助。
2、实体框架的常见开发方式
实体框架是一种常见的软件开发方式,它在许多领域中得到广泛应用。本文将介绍实体框架的基本概念以及常见的开发方式。
实体框架是一种用于将数据存储到数据库中的技术。它提供了一种简化数据访问的方法,使开发人员能够更加专注于业务逻辑的实现,而不必过多关注数据库操作的细节。
在实体框架中,开发人员首先需要定义实体类。实体类是与数据库表相对应的对象,它包含了表中的字段以及相应的属性和方法。通过实体类,开发人员可以方便地对数据库进行增删改查的操作。
常见的实体框架开发方式之一是代码优先。在代码优先的开发方式中,开发人员首先根据业务需求定义实体类,然后通过实体类生成数据库表结构。这种方式可以提高开发效率,因为开发人员可以直接使用面向对象的编程语言来定义实体类,而不必关注数据库的具体实现。
另一种常见的开发方式是数据库优先。在数据库优先的开发方式中,开发人员首先设计数据库表结构,然后通过工具生成相应的实体类。这种方式适用于已经存在数据库的情况,开发人员可以根据数据库表结构自动生成实体类,从而减少了手动编写代码的工作量。
除了代码优先和数据库优先的开发方式,还有一种常见的开发方式是模型优先。在模型优先的开发方式中,开发人员首先设计实体类和数据库表结构,然后通过工具生成相应的数据库脚本和代码。这种方式可以在开发过程中更好地将实体类和数据库表结构进行同步,从而减少了出错的可能性。
无论是哪种开发方式,实体框架都提供了一种便捷的数据访问方式。开发人员可以通过简单的方法调用来实现对数据库的增删改查操作,而不必编写复杂的SQL语句。实体框架还提供了一些高级特性,如事务管理、缓存和查询优化等,可以进一步提高系统的性能和可维护性。
实体框架是一种常见的软件开发方式,它通过简化数据访问的过程,提高了开发效率和系统性能。无论是代码优先、数据库优先还是模型优先的开发方式,实体框架都可以帮助开发人员更好地实现业务逻辑,从而提供更好的用户体验。
3、web前端框架技术
Web前端框架技术
Web前端框架技术是指用于构建用户界面的一种技术。它是Web开发中不可或缺的一部分,能够帮助开发者更高效地构建复杂的交互式应用程序。随着互联网的快速发展,Web前端框架技术也在不断演进和壮大。
Web前端框架技术的出现,极大地简化了Web开发的流程。传统的Web开发中,开发者需要手动编写HTML、CSS和JavaScript代码,这样的开发方式既繁琐又容易出错。而使用前端框架技术,开发者只需要关注业务逻辑,通过框架提供的组件和工具,可以快速构建出美观、高效的网页应用。
目前,市场上有许多优秀的前端框架可供选择,如React、Vue和Angular等。这些框架都具有自己的特点和优势,开发者可以根据项目需求选择更合适的框架进行开发。例如,React是由Facebook开发的一款轻量级框架,它采用了组件化的开发思想,可以提高代码的可复用性和可维护性;Vue是一款渐进式框架,它的核心库只关注视图层,非常易于上手和学习;而Angular是由Google开发的一款完整的框架,它提供了更多的功能和工具,适用于大型应用的开发。
使用前端框架技术,开发者可以快速构建出具有良好用户体验的Web应用。框架提供了丰富的组件和工具,开发者可以根据需求选择合适的组件进行组合,从而实现复杂的交互效果。框架还提供了一些优化工具,如虚拟DOM、异步渲染等,可以提高应用的性能和响应速度。
前端框架技术也存在一些挑战和问题。由于框架的快速发展和更新迭代,开发者需要不断学习和掌握新的技术和概念,以保持竞争力。前端框架技术在一些老旧的浏览器中可能存在兼容性问题,开发者需要进行兼容性测试和处理。前端框架技术的学习曲线相对较陡,对于初学者来说可能需要花费一定的时间和精力。
Web前端框架技术在现代Web开发中扮演着重要的角色。它能够帮助开发者提高开发效率,构建出优秀的用户界面。随着技术的不断发展,前端框架技术也在不断进化和完善,为Web开发带来更多的可能性。无论是初学者还是有经验的开发者,都应该不断学习和掌握前端框架技术,以适应Web开发的需求和挑战。
通过本文的探讨,我们可以得出结论:动态网页前端框架的构建方式是一个不断演变和发展的过程。从更早的静态网页到现在的动态网页,前端框架的发展经历了多个阶段。在这个过程中,我们看到了技术的不断创新和进步,也见证了人们对于用户体验的追求和需求的变化。无论是传统的服务端渲染还是现代的客户端渲染,每种构建方式都有其独特的优势和适用场景。我们也需要注意到,随着技术的不断发展,前端框架的构建方式可能会继续演变,我们需要保持学习和适应的态度。通过不断学习和实践,我们可以更好地掌握动态网页前端框架的构建方式,为用户提供更好的体验和功能。